1 arrested, 2 escape after Atwater police chase
One man was arrested early Monday, and two others escaped after a short vehicle chase in Atwater, according to the Police Department.
Antonio D. Ayala, 19, of Livingston is believed to have been a passenger in a stolen silver Acura that briefly fled from Atwater police, Lt. Samuel Joseph said.
Officers tried to stop the vehicle about 1:15 a.m. in the 2600 block of Shaffer Road, but the car did not yield, officers said.
The vehicle stopped a short time later on Shaffer and two people ran, police said.
Ayala, whom police described as a known gang member, remained in the vehicle, which had recently been reported stolen out of Merced, officers said.
He was booked into the John Latorraca Correctional Facility on suspicion of possession of stolen property. His bail was set at $20,000, according to booking records.
Joseph said police are continuing to search for the two people who ran from the vehicle. They were described by police only as Latino males with possible gang ties.
